This book continues right where Saving 6 left of. We basically get all of Keeping 13 from Joey's perspective and omg I thought that was horrible, but Joey's POV was brutal. We also get to see the decline of his mental health and his struggles with addiction in all forms.

Oh Joey. Oh Aoife. I just want to hug them. Joey suffered so much. And Aoife was incredibly loyal to the end. But they were both kids and they didn't deserve that. Joey's troubles were so many and so heavy, I don't understand how strong Aoife remained till the end. But by the end of the book, I was so damn proud of them. They'll be okay, I know it.
